Synonyms for arrogate

Verb

1. claim, lay claim, arrogate, request, bespeak, call for, quest
usage: demand as being one's due or property; assert one's right or title to; "He claimed his suitcases at the airline counter"; "Mr. Smith claims special tax exemptions because he is a foreign resident"
2. arrogate, assign, claim, lay claim, arrogate
usage: make undue claims to having
3. assume, usurp, seize, take over, arrogate, take
usage: seize and take control without authority and possibly with force; take as one's right or possession; "He assumed to himself the right to fill all positions in the town"; "he usurped my rights"; "She seized control of the throne after her husband died"
